Output 7a438f66a627d0a24af729ce077e7773072aa62c71b8f63765db65fc3f99f28b:1

value
330048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df821f5242c263b1fc9624806a52e55a40dd25aa OP_EQUAL
address
3N4pVP4kiBrzhDrdTs4ZHGfup5bfnqjnAP
transaction
7a438f66a627d0a24af729ce077e7773072aa62c71b8f63765db65fc3f99f28b
confirmations
331738
spent
true